Ferry Boat Accidents

Ferry boats are often large commuter vessels that carry a lot of passengers. Ferry boats can be speedy and therefore injuries from accidents are likely to be serious. These accidents can involve collisions with docks, other boats or objects, and could result in injuries due to impact such as broken bones or concussions. These accidents may also involve slipping and falling on the stairs that aren't well lit or on other walkways or being thrown around the vessel's cabin when it is moving in the water.

In the majority cases, those who suffer injuries in a boating accident may be awarded substantial compensation. This could include medical expenses loss of wages, suffering and other damages. The amount of compensation you receive will be contingent on the severity of the injury and how long it takes you to recover.

In many cases, the owner or operator of a vessel will be held responsible for the accident and the resulting injuries in the event they violated their obligation to use reasonable care and expertise when operating the boat. A successful negligence claim must be supported by evidence that demonstrates how the accident happened and that a prudent and reasonable boat operator would have avoided the incident if they had acted appropriately.

Boating Accidents Caused By Inattention Operators

Similar to motor vehicle drivers, boat operators must exercise the same level of care and concentration while operating their vessels. If they fail to adhere to this serious boating accidents can occur. They can result in drowning injuries, brain trauma injury from a boat striking the swimmer, fire injuries, and other severe wounds. Fortunately, those who suffer from these accidents are entitled to compensation for medical bills or property damage, as well as suffering through personal injury claims.

It is possible for a boater to become distracted or unattentive while on the water, no matter how long they've been operating their vessel. This is a major cause of boating accidents. It can cause collisions with other vessels, stationary objects or swimmers. It can also cause passengers slip overboard or slide into a beach bar.

Boating Accidents Caused by Intoxication

Although it might be tempting to think of bodies of water similar to the Wild West, they are actually very controlled. Boating accidents are often a result of various federal and state laws and may even be a violation of maritime law.

Many boating accidents are caused the same factors that lead to car accidents, such as excessive speeding drinking and driving and reckless operating. Drinking alcohol is particularly hazardous on the water because it can affect the person's balance, coordination and balance in addition to causing fatigue and affect judgment. These issues can result in life-changing injuries.

It is illegal to operate a boat under the impaired by alcohol or drugs. This is among the most common causes of boating accident and death. Anyone found to be in violation of this law may be subject to the same penalties if they were caught driving while impaired.

Boating accidents can result in serious injuries such as back and neck injuries, brain injuries, burns and broken bones. These injuries can have a long-lasting impact on the victim's quality of life and their ability to work. These injuries can be expensive to treat and may require a lifetime of care.
